2013-08-28 2 views
-2

У меня есть проблема прямо сейчас с ImageManager, это происходит, когда имя изображения содержит специальные символы, такие как «$,%, & ...» У меня уже есть проверка, чтобы не разрешать пользователю загружать больше изображений со специальными символами, но прямо сейчас на сервере есть некоторые изображения, содержащие специальные символы, и нам также нужно их загрузить, поэтому ImageManager не работает с предварительным просмотром, когда специальный символ находится в изображении, кто-нибудь знает решение для этого?Telerik ImageManager Предварительный просмотр изображения не работает

ответ

0

Учитывая, что диспетчер изображений telerik не загружает изображения со специальными символами в имени, вы можете создать простую функцию (скорее всего, только для запуска один раз), которая переименует существующие изображения на вашем сервере с запрещенными символами с чем-то другим, например заменив «$» на «_dollar_».

По моему предыдущему опыту с элементами управления часто возникают проблемы, но дезинфицирование существующих данных всегда является предпочтительным вариантом, поскольку это предотвращает необходимость выполнения дополнительной обработки.

+0

Я знаю, что могу переименовать изображения и избежать проблемы, но я не могу этого сделать, поскольку эти изображения используются для отправки электронных писем, поэтому переименование изображений является решением, поэтому я ищу решение в управление для загрузки изображений специальными символами ... – Vazqusa

+0

Я получил решение, это было вызвано пулом APP, поэтому я просто переключился на Classic вместо интегрирования и теперь работает просто отлично :) – Vazqusa

 Смежные вопросы

  • Нет связанных вопросов^_^